Output 8fd51c090a5ea42dd4cb9a9e0b3b284ec50af9090981b6647ef5d8527d2be5b7:8

value
2126327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3eee13264d83cc67a948f13708b31efa6526a1 OP_EQUAL
address
35uYPpVNr6HesdTmb5XahgpZz9CgVP4fmw
transaction
8fd51c090a5ea42dd4cb9a9e0b3b284ec50af9090981b6647ef5d8527d2be5b7